Located on the San Antonio Military Medical Center campus, Joint Base Fort Sam Houston, Texas, NAMRU-SA serves as one of the leading research and development laboratories of the U.S. Navy. The Command's Mission is to conduct gap driven combat casualty care, craniofacial, and directed energy research to improve survival, operational readiness, and safety of Department of Defense personnel engaged in routine and expeditionary operations. 

A research opportunity is available with the Naval Medical Research Unit (NAMRU), located in San Antonio, TX. NAMRU is seeking a Postdoctoral Fellow with an educational background in Molecular Biology, Microbiology, or Biochemistry.
 
Research in developing (1) Prevention Strategies for Dental Caries Using Phage Therapy and (2) Novel Diagnosis and Treatment of Envenomation by Venomous Marine Animals for Marine Expeditionary Forces.

Research activities will include:
a. Identify and help design consensus/unique amino acid sequences of venom proteins.
b. Screen phage display library against venom peptide.
c. Conduct panning, ELISA, and venom activity assay.
d. Evaluate the various effects and efficacy of antivenom on inhibiting cellular and systemic damage induced by snake venoms.
f. Collaborate with engineers, biologists, analytical chemists, toxicologists, and veterinary science staff.
g. Initiate new hypothesis driven research and prepare technical report, manuscript, poster, abstract, and proposal.
h. Participate in key meetings with team members and collaborating organizations.
